Flynn highlights importance of smear testing

Sinn Féin MLA Órlaithí Flynn has encouraged women to get a smear test to help tackle cervical cancer.

Speaking on Cervical Cancer Awareness Week, the West Belfast MLA said: 

“Smear testing is vital to the early detection of cervical cancer.

“Around one in 38 women in the north will develop cervical cancer. These are stark figures and reinforce the importance of getting a smear test. 

“Women between the age of 25 and 64 are offered a test, while all women registered with a GP will be automatically invited for a smear. 

“It is important that we all attend our cancer screening tests as the earlier this disease is caught, the more effective treatment can be.”
